All-day wear and exercise For all-day wear when youre not exercising, wear the device on your wrist horizontally, a fingers width below your wrist bone and lying flat, the same way you would put on a watch. 1. Experiment with wearing the watch higher on your wrist during exercise. Because the blood flow in your arm increases the farther up you go, moving the watch up a couple of inches can improve the heart rate signal. Also, many exercises such as bike riding or weight lifting require you to bend your wrist frequently, which is more likely to interfere with the heart rate signal if the watch is lower on your wrist. Failure to connect to smartphone The watch will disconnect from your smartphone in the following cases:
1. Smartphone Bluetooth is off or exceeds the Bluetooth connection range (the maximum Bluetooth connection range is 10 meters and can easily be reduced by walls, furniture, etc.) 2. The VeryFitPro app is closed on the phone. (This can occur automatically under certain circumstances.) To reconnect the watch to your smartphone, please kindly take the following steps:
1. Go to your smartphone system Settings, find the VeryFitPro app and enable the Location and all Notifications. 2. Clear all running / background processes on your smartphone. Go to the VeryFitPro app and swipe down
"Homepage", then the watch will reconnect to your smartphone and update data. Always be aware of your surroundings while exercising. Battery Warnings A lithium-ion battery is used in this device. If these guidelines are not followed, batteries may experience a shortened life span or may cause fire, chemical burn, electrolyte leakage, and/or injury. Do NOT disassemble, modify, remanufacture, puncture or damage the device or batteries. Do NOT remove or attempt to remove the non-user-replace-

While the optical wrist heart rate monitor technology typically provides the best estimate of a user's heart rate, there are inherent limitations with the technology that may cause some of the heart rate readings to be inaccurate under certain circumstances, including the user's physical characteristics, fit of the device, and type and intensity of activity. The smart watch relies on sensors that track your movements and other metrics. The data and information provided by these devices are intended to be a close estimation of your activity and metrics tracked, but may not be completely accurate, including step, sleep, distance, heart rate, and calorie data. If you have eczema, allergies or asthma, you may be more likely to experience skin irritation or allergies from a wearable device. Whether you have the conditions above or not, if you start to experience any discomfort or skin irritation on your wrist, remove your device. If symptoms persist longer than 2-3 days of not using your device, contact your doctor. If you sweat for more than two hours while wearing your watch, be sure to clean and dry your band and your wrist to avoid skin irritation. Prolonged rubbing and pressure may irritate the skin, so give your wrist a break by removing the band for an hour after extended wear. Maintenance Regularly clean your wrist and the smart watch, especially after sweating during exercise or being exposed to substances such as soap or detergent which may adhere to the internal side of the watch. Do NOT wash the watch with household cleanser. Please use soapless detergent, rinse thoroughly and wipe with a soft towel or napkin. While the watch is water resistant, wearing a wet band is not good for your skin. If your bands get wetfor example after sweating or showeringclean and dry them thoroughly before putting them back on your wrist. Be sure your skin is dry before you put your bands back on. Do not bring your device into contact with any sharp objects, as this could cause scratches and other damage.
